研究以45#钢代替原H_2-077数控机床镶钢导轨用GCr15钢,以激光表面淬火工艺取代原全件淬火工艺,达到减小导轨变形及降低生产成本的目的。试验结果表明,用优化了的激光工艺参数加工的镶钢导轨表面,其金相组织硬度得到了一定程度的提高,同时,大大减小了导轨的变形。
In order to reduce the deformation of the guide rail and reduce the production cost, the 45 # steel was used to replace the original H_2-077 CNC machine tool steel with GCr15 steel, the laser surface hardening process was used to replace the original full quenching process. The experimental results show that the hardness of the microstructure of the inlayed steel rail surface processed with the optimized laser process parameters is improved to a certain degree, and the deformation of the guide rail is greatly reduced.
